자동차 에어백 센서 세계 시장은 2030년까지 11억 달러에 달할 전망

2024년에 7억 5,110만 달러로 추정되는 자동차 에어백 센서 세계 시장은 2024년부터 2030년까지 CAGR 5.9%로 성장하여 2030년에는 11억 달러에 달할 것으로 예측됩니다. 이 보고서에서 분석한 부문 중 하나인 승용차 용도는 CAGR 5.4%를 기록하며 분석 기간 종료시에는 5억 7,590만 달러에 달할 것으로 예측됩니다. LCV 용도 부문의 성장률은 분석 기간 동안 CAGR 6.9%로 추정됩니다.

미국 시장은 1억 9,740만 달러로 추정, 중국은 CAGR 5.8%로 성장 예측

미국의 자동차 에어백 센서 시장은 2024년에 1억 9,740만 달러로 추정됩니다. 세계 2위 경제 대국인 중국은 분석 기간인 2024-2030년 CAGR 5.8%로 2030년까지 1억 7,070만 달러의 시장 규모에 달할 것으로 예측됩니다. 기타 주목할 만한 지역별 시장으로는 일본과 캐나다가 있고, 분석 기간 동안 CAGR은 각각 5.4%와 5.0%로 예측됩니다. 유럽에서는 독일이 CAGR 4.8%로 성장할 것으로 예측됩니다.

최신 자동차 안전 시스템에서 에어백 센서가 얼마나 중요한가?

에어백 센서는 자동차 패시브 안전 시스템의 골격을 형성하고 충돌 시 에어백 전개 시기와 힘을 결정하는 데 중요한 역할을 합니다. 이 센서들은 급격한 감속, 충격의 정도, 충돌 방향을 감지하고, 종종 생사를 가르는 순간적인 보호 동작을 시작하도록 설계되어 있습니다. 소비자와 규제 당국의 안전에 대한 기대치가 높아짐에 따라 에어백 센서는 단순한 가속도계에서 탑승자의 크기, 좌석 위치, 안전벨트 상태 등 보다 광범위한 데이터를 분석하는 복잡한 멀티 센서 구성으로 진화해 왔습니다. 이러한 진화를 통해 다양한 충돌 시나리오에서 부상을 최소화하는 적응형 에어백을 전개할 수 있게 되었습니다. 특히 측면 충돌, 전복 및 보행자 보호 시스템은 센서의 정확성과 반응성에 대한 새로운 요구 사항을 제시합니다. 오늘날 전면, 측면, 커튼, 무릎 등 여러 개의 에어백을 통합한 차량이 증가함에 따라 광범위한 지능형 센서 네트워크의 필요성이 그 어느 때보다 높아지고 있으며, 에어백 센서는 자동차 안전 아키텍처에서 필수적인 구성요소로 자리 잡고 있습니다.

센서의 정확성과 반응성을 높이는 기술 혁신이란?

에어백 센서의 기술적 정교함은 더 높은 충돌 안전성에 대한 요구와 함께 높아지고 있습니다. 최신 센서는 압전, 정전 용량, MEMS(마이크로 전자 기계 시스템) 기술의 조합을 이용하여 초고속으로 정확한 충격 감지를 실현하고 있습니다. 이 센서들은 현재 밀리초 단위로 신호를 처리하는 첨단 제어장치와 통합되어 정확한 타이밍에 에어백을 전개할 수 있도록 하고 있습니다. 이 제어 장치에 내장된 소프트웨어 알고리즘은 오탐지를 필터링하고 차량 속도, 충격 각도, 탑승자 상태와 같은 실시간 상황 데이터에 따라 반응을 조정합니다. 또한 CAN 및 FlexRay와 같은 차량 통신 네트워크와의 통합을 통해 센서와 액추에이터 간의 신속한 데이터 교환을 보장합니다. 또한, 신형 자동차는 예측 분석과 AI를 활용하여 센서가 충돌 시나리오를 예측하고 안전 시스템을 미리 작동시킬 수 있도록 하는 예측 분석과 AI를 활용하고 있습니다. 전기자동차와 하이브리드 자동차에서는 센서 설계에 대한 특별한 고려가 열과 진동 문제를 해결하고 다양한 플랫폼에서 성능의 신뢰성을 보장하고 있습니다. 이러한 기술 혁신은 점점 더 복잡해지는 실제 환경에 대한 에어백 시스템의 대응 방식을 재정의하고 있습니다.

전 세계 규제와 소비자 취향은 어떻게 시장을 형성하고 있는가?

첨단 에어백 센서 시스템이 널리 채택된 계기는 정부의 안전 의무화입니다. 유럽연합(EU), 미국 및 일부 아시아 시장에서는 충돌 테스트 프로토콜에서 최고 수준의 안전성을 보장하기 위해 다중 에어백 장착을 의무화하고 있으며, 이를 위해서는 강력한 센서 인프라가 필요합니다. 이러한 규제는 점차 강화되고 있으며, OEM은 기술 혁신과 규정 준수를 위해 노력하고 있습니다. 동시에 자동차 안전에 대한 소비자의 인식이 크게 높아지면서 에어백 전개 효율성이 자동차 구매 결정에 중요한 요소로 작용하고 있습니다. 자동차 제조업체들은 고급차뿐만 아니라 이코노미 클래스 및 중급 차량에도 고급 에어백 시스템을 표준으로 장착하여 대응하고 있습니다. 보험사들도 강화된 패시브 안전 시스템을 장착한 차량에 보험 혜택을 제공함으로써 채택에 영향을 미치고 있습니다. 한편, 세계 안전 기준의 조화는 센서가 풍부한 에어백 시스템의 국경을 초월한 채택을 촉진하고, 다국적 OEM이 생산을 간소화하여 더 넓은 시장에 대응할 수 있도록 돕고 있습니다. 규제 당국과 소비자의 이중적인 지원은 이 시장의 지속적인 성장 궤도를 보장하고 있습니다.

센서의 보급을 가속화하는 시장 역학은?

자동차 에어백 센서 시장의 성장은 몇 가지 요인에 의해 주도되고 있습니다. 주요 요인 중 하나는 자동차 1대당 에어백 장착 대수가 증가하면서 보다 진보된 분산형 센서 네트워크가 요구되고 있다는 점입니다. 전 세계 자동차 생산량 증가, 특히 신흥 시장의 자동차 생산량 증가는 센서가 대응할 수 있는 시장을 확대하고 있습니다. 센서의 소형화 및 비용 최적화의 급속한 발전으로 차량 가격에 큰 영향을 미치지 않으면서도 보다 광범위하게 배포할 수 있게 되었습니다. 종합적인 안전 사양을 갖춘 SUV와 크로스오버의 인기가 높아지면서 사이드 에어백 및 커튼 에어백 센서에 대한 수요가 증가하고 있습니다. 또한, 최종사용자들이 가족용 및 노인용 차량에 대한 관심이 높아짐에 따라 신뢰할 수 있는 에어백 시스템의 중요성이 커지고 있습니다. 또한, 자동차 제조업체들이 엄격한 충돌 테스트 기준을 충족하기 위해 노력하고 있기 때문에 신차 개발 시 센서 업그레이드가 우선순위가 되고 있습니다. 자동차의 전동화 및 반자동 운전과 같은 추세는 여러 안전 시스템과 연동할 수 있는 통합형 고속 센서의 역할을 더욱 증대시키고 있습니다. 이러한 요인들이 결합되어 수동 안전의 상황이 재구성되고 있으며, 에어백 센서는 혁신과 배치의 최전선에 있습니다.

Global Automotive Airbag Sensors Market to Reach US$1.1 Billion by 2030

The global market for Automotive Airbag Sensors estimated at US$751.1 Million in the year 2024, is expected to reach US$1.1 Billion by 2030, growing at a CAGR of 5.9% over the analysis period 2024-2030. Passenger Cars Application, one of the segments analyzed in the report, is expected to record a 5.4% CAGR and reach US$575.9 Million by the end of the analysis period. Growth in the LCVs Application segment is estimated at 6.9% CAGR over the analysis period.

The U.S. Market is Estimated at US$197.4 Million While China is Forecast to Grow at 5.8% CAGR

The Automotive Airbag Sensors market in the U.S. is estimated at US$197.4 Million in the year 2024. China, the world's second largest economy, is forecast to reach a projected market size of US$170.7 Million by the year 2030 trailing a CAGR of 5.8% over the analysis period 2024-2030. Among the other noteworthy geographic markets are Japan and Canada, each forecast to grow at a CAGR of 5.4% and 5.0% respectively over the analysis period. Within Europe, Germany is forecast to grow at approximately 4.8% CAGR.

How Critical Are Airbag Sensors to Modern Vehicle Safety Systems?

Airbag sensors form the backbone of vehicular passive safety systems, playing a crucial role in determining the timing and force of airbag deployment during collisions. These sensors are engineered to detect sudden deceleration, impact severity, and crash direction, initiating split-second protective actions that often make the difference between life and death. As safety expectations escalate among consumers and regulators alike, airbag sensors have evolved from simple accelerometers to complex, multi-sensor configurations that analyze a broader set of data points, including occupant size, seat position, and seatbelt status. This evolution allows for adaptive airbag deployment that minimizes injury across a variety of crash scenarios. In particular, side-impact, rollover, and pedestrian protection systems have placed new demands on sensor accuracy and responsiveness. With more vehicles now integrating multiple airbags-front, side, curtain, and knee-the need for an extensive network of intelligent sensors is more critical than ever, establishing airbag sensors as indispensable components in automotive safety architecture.

What Technological Innovations Are Enhancing Sensor Precision and Response?

The technological sophistication of airbag sensors has grown in tandem with the demand for higher crash survivability. Modern sensors utilize a combination of piezoelectric, capacitive, and MEMS (micro-electromechanical systems) technologies to achieve ultra-fast and accurate impact detection. These sensors are now integrated with advanced control units that process signals in milliseconds, enabling precisely timed airbag deployment. Software algorithms embedded in these control units filter out false positives and adapt responses based on real-time contextual data, such as vehicle speed, impact angle, and occupant status. Moreover, integration with vehicle communication networks like CAN and FlexRay ensures rapid data exchange between sensors and actuators. The use of predictive analytics and AI in newer models is also pushing the envelope, allowing sensors to anticipate collision scenarios and pre-activate safety systems. In electric and hybrid vehicles, special considerations in sensor design address thermal and vibration challenges, ensuring performance reliability across varied platforms. These innovations are redefining how airbag systems respond to increasingly complex real-world conditions.

How Are Global Regulations and Consumer Preferences Reshaping the Market?

Government-imposed safety mandates are among the strongest catalysts for the widespread adoption of sophisticated airbag sensor systems. In the European Union, United States, and several Asian markets, crash-test protocols now require the inclusion of multiple airbags to secure top safety ratings, thereby necessitating a robust sensor infrastructure. These regulations are becoming progressively stringent, pushing OEMs to innovate and comply. At the same time, consumer awareness around vehicular safety has grown significantly, with airbag deployment effectiveness becoming a key factor in vehicle purchasing decisions. Automakers are responding by making advanced airbag systems standard, not just in luxury vehicles but also in economy and mid-range segments. Insurance providers, too, are influencing adoption by offering policy benefits for vehicles with enhanced passive safety systems. Meanwhile, global harmonization of safety standards is prompting cross-border adoption of sensor-rich airbag systems, allowing multinational OEMs to streamline production and cater to wider markets. The dual push from regulators and consumers ensures a sustained growth trajectory for this market.

Which Market Dynamics Are Accelerating Sensor Deployment?

The growth in the automotive airbag sensors market is driven by several factors. One of the primary drivers is the increasing number of airbags being installed per vehicle, requiring more sophisticated and distributed sensor networks. The rise in global vehicle production, particularly in emerging markets, is expanding the addressable market for these sensors. Rapid advancements in sensor miniaturization and cost optimization have enabled wider deployment without significantly impacting vehicle pricing. The growing popularity of SUVs and crossovers, which often include comprehensive safety suites, has led to increased demand for side and curtain airbag sensors. End-users are also placing greater emphasis on family-friendly and senior-friendly vehicles, heightening the importance of reliable airbag systems. Additionally, as automotive OEMs strive to meet stringent crash test standards, sensor upgrades are being prioritized in new vehicle development. Trends such as vehicle electrification and semi-autonomous driving further amplify the role of integrated, high-speed sensors that can coordinate with multiple safety systems. Together, these factors are reshaping the landscape of passive safety, with airbag sensors at the forefront of innovation and deployment.
